Destiny Expansion "The Taken King" Launching in September for $40 - Report

Destiny continues to grow.

208 Comments

As rumored, the next major Destiny expansion is called The Taken King and will launch on September 15. That's according to Kotaku, which obtained marketing material for the expansion and also corroborated the details with other, unnamed sources. The expansion will reportedly cost $40, which is twice the cost of Destiny's two previous expansions, The Dark Below and House of Wolves.

No Caption Provided

Among other things, The Taken King is said to offer a new subclass for Destiny's three classes. A new elemental super ability is also supposedly on the way.

Per Kotaku: "An electrical storm for Warlocks (arc); a gravity bow for Hunters (void); and a flaming hammer for Titans (solar). Hardcore Destiny players will notice that each of these abilities revolves around the element each respective class lacks today."

The Taken King will also have a new raid in which players fight against Oryx, the father of Crota, according to the leak. The expansion is also expected to include new multiplayer maps, more Strikes, and more.

Publisher Activision previously referred to a new Destiny expansion coming this fall as the game's biggest ever. The Taken King would be the first Destiny expansion offered outside of the game's DLC pass.

The name "The Taken King" was first spotted earlier this year through trademark filings. Just last week, it popped up again through Red Bull.

Bungie did not comment on this report when approached by Kotaku.

For its part, however, Bungie has said it will have some Destiny news to announce at E3 next week. The developer also recently trademarked something called "Eververse."
